PC63.16/D4.0, Nov 2015 is a draft American National Standard guide focused on electrostatic discharge test methodologies and acceptance criteria for electronic equipment. It is intended to help define how ESD testing is planned, performed, and judged, especially where consistent results are needed across design and compliance activities. For engineers working with sensitive electronics, PC63.16/D4.0, Nov 2015 provides a technical framework for evaluating immunity and comparing outcomes more reliably.

What is PC63.16/D4.0, Nov 2015?

PC63.16/D4.0, Nov 2015 addresses the practical side of electrostatic discharge evaluation for electronic equipment. As a guide, it is concerned with test methodologies and acceptance criteria rather than a single device type or product category. In the context of fields, waves, and electromagnetics, the document helps structure how ESD tests are conducted, what conditions should be considered, and how results may be interpreted for engineering and compliance purposes.

Where is PC63.16/D4.0, Nov 2015 used?

This standard is typically relevant wherever electronic equipment must be checked for susceptibility to electrostatic discharge during development, qualification, or quality verification. It may be used in laboratory test setups, product validation workflows, and equipment design reviews involving sensitive circuitry, control units, or interconnected electronic assemblies. PC63.16/D4.0, Nov 2015 is especially useful when teams need a shared approach to ESD test methods and acceptance decisions across design, test, and procurement functions.

Why is PC63.16/D4.0, Nov 2015 important?

Consistent ESD testing is important because electrostatic events can cause temporary malfunctions, latent damage, or rejected test results if acceptance criteria are unclear. PC63.16/D4.0, Nov 2015 helps support more repeatable evaluation by defining a clearer testing and decision framework. That can improve design control, reduce ambiguity in compliance work, and support more dependable comparisons between equipment, test sites, and production lots.
